Balfour Declaration - Wikipedia. The Balfour Declaration was a letter dated 2 November 1. United Kingdom's Foreign Secretary. Arthur James Balfour to Walter Rothschild, 2nd Baron Rothschild, a leader of the British Jewish community, for transmission to the Zionist Federation of Great Britain and Ireland. It read: His Majesty's government view with favour the establishment in Palestine of a national home for the Jewish people, and will use their best endeavours to facilitate the achievement of this object, it being clearly understood that nothing shall be done which may prejudice the civil and religious rights of existing non- Jewish communities in Palestine, or the rights and political status enjoyed by Jews in any other country. The original document is kept at the British Library. He had an unusually wide four- octave voice range that would enable him to voice everything from the thundering basso profundo of the unseen . He began his career on radio in 1. During that time, he was involved in more than 2. TV appearances; like many voice actors of the time, his appearances were often uncredited. Frees' early radio career was cut short when he was drafted into World War II where he fought at Normandy, France on D- Day. He was wounded in action and was returned to the United States for a year of recuperation. He attended the Chouinard Art Institute under the G. I. When his first wife's health failed, he decided to drop out and return to radio work. One of his few starring roles in this medium was as Jethro Dumont/Green Lama in the 1. The Green Lama, as well as a syndicated anthology series The Player, in which Frees narrated and played all the parts. Frees was often called upon in the 1. These dubs extended from a few lines to entire roles. This can be noticed rather clearly in the films Grand Prix (as Izo Yamura) and Midway where Frees reads for Toshiro Mifune's performances as Admiral Yamamoto; or in the film Some Like It Hot, in which Frees provides the voice of funeral director Mozzarella as well as much of the falsetto voice for Tony Curtis' female character Josephine. Frees also dubbed the entire role of Eddie in the Disney film The Ugly Dachshund, replacing actor Dick Wessel, who had died of a sudden heart attack after completion of principal photography. Frees also dubbed Humphrey Bogart in his final film The Harder They Fall. Bogart was suffering at the time from what would be diagnosed as esophageal cancer and thus could barely be heard in some takes, hence the need for Frees to dub in his voice. He also voiced the cars in the comedy The Great Race. Unlike many voice actors who did most of their work for one studio, Frees worked extensively with at least nine of the major animation production companies of the 2. Walt Disney Studios, Walter Lantz Studios, UPA, Hanna- Barbera, Filmation, Metro- Goldwyn- Mayer, De. Patie- Freleng Enterprises, Jay Ward Productions, and Rankin/Bass. Some of Frees' most memorable voices were for various Disney projects. Frees voiced Disney's Professor Ludwig Von Drake in eighteen episodes of the Disney anthology television series. The character also appeared on many Disneyland Records. Von Drake's introductory cartoon, An Adventure in Color, featured The Spectrum Song, sung by Frees as Von Drake. A different Frees recording of this song appeared on a children's record, and was later reissued on CD. This short originally aired in the same television episode as Von Drake's first appearance. Frees also had a small live- action role for Disney in the 1. The Shaggy Dog, playing Dr. Galvin, a military psychiatrist who attempts to understand why Mr. Daniels believes a shaggy dog can uncover a spy ring. He also did the film's opening narration. His other Disney credits, most of them narration for segments of the Disney anthology television series, include the following: For his contributions to the Disney legacy, Frees was honored posthumously as a Disney Legend on October 9, 2. He was also the traffic cop, ticket- taker, and Santa Claus in Frosty the Snowman in 1. He was several voices, including Eon the Terrible, in Rudolph's Shiny New Year in 1. In 1. 96. 8, he appeared as Captain Jones in the Thanksgiving special The Mouse on the Mayflower, and that Christmas he appeared as the father of the Drummer Boy, Ali, and as the three Wise Men in The Little Drummer Boy. He provided the voices for several J. Tolkien characters (most notably the dwarf Bombur) in Rankin/Bass animated versions of The Hobbit and The Return of the King. He also voiced King Haggard's wizard Mabruk in The Last Unicorn and provided several voices for the Jackson Five cartoon series between 1.
